I put a better product called second skin in my car to save rattles. Getting ready to pull the entire back end out and do it along with some mass loaded vinyl.
try to get a deck with 4v outputs, and with a subwoofer output. The way I recomend is using the subwoofer output to feed the factory amps, but bypassing them for the tweeters and letting the decks power play them. A line driver is a low level amp that will convert a 1-2v rca signal into a 5-8v rca signal. This is all before the amplifier gets it and makes it louder yet.
